Transaction 312517e9dee560cd6708d92969988e3c63d1d901e75e6b43f2eb939ed7578eea
1 Input
1 Output
-
312517e9dee560cd6708d92969988e3c63d1d901e75e6b43f2eb939ed7578eea:0
- value
- 166860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abcadc38c63a6f647dccbc97cb25f43bca011c18 OP_EQUAL
- address
- 3HMNVKiFPugRyWQshkuMzNsRK2VXWEn8zQ